Frenchies are susceptible to breathing issues and back injuries. The jelly-like cushion between the vertebrae can break or slip and put pressure on the spinal chord. This can lead to painful spasms in the muscles as well as a hunched back and a reluctance to move the rear legs. If you experience any of these symptoms, take your Frenchie to a veterinarian immediately.
Frenchies are also prone to hearing infections. The folds in the skin and tissue of the ear can hold water, which can cause a yeast or bacterial infection. Infections can lead to head shaking and odor, as well as inflammation. Regular ear cleanings using pH-balanced ear cleaning products designed for dogs can reduce the frequency of these issues.
They're also predisposed to stomach problems, including food allergies and inflammatory bowel disease, which can lead to diarrhea and soft stool. Treatment typically consists of prescription diets and französische bulldogge welpen zu kaufen medications.
Frenchies may suffer back injuries if they jump from high surfaces. Teach them to use stairs instead of jumping onto couches or other furniture. Hip dysplasia is a different condition that can affect Frenchies. The cartilage that cushions joints begins to degrade. This may cause stiffness and pain in the joints and eventually arthritis. In severe instances surgery may be required. Regular exercise, weight management and a balanced diet can help to prevent these health conditions.

French Bulldogs have a high intelligence and are easy to train. They are keen to delight their owners and love having fun with. While they may not need much exercise, training them to walk on a leash is crucial to avoid accidents and let them explore their environment safely.
Frenchies are extremely organized and like to have an agenda. Setting up a regular routine for eating and playtimes as well as training sessions can help them to learn. Also, try to socialize them whenever you can and introduce them to other animals and people in safe environments. This will help them feel at ease in various situations and prevent them from becoming anxious or französische bulldogge mit langer nase kaufen (ds.yama.systems) aggressive in new environments or with animals.
Positive reinforcement is the most effective method to train dogs. This means rewarding your Frenchie for Französische Bulldoggen Kaufen oder adoptieren (Https://burevestnik.ru/) good behavior with treats, praise and even a kiss. Positive reinforcement will assist your Frenchie to comprehend what is expected of them and will increase the chances that they will continue these behavior patterns in the future.
Utilizing negative reinforcement in training can backfire, leading to a stubborn temperament in your puppy. It is best to only use punishment only when absolutely necessary and not with physical punishment, which can cause damage to your Frenchie's neck. It is important to teach your Frenchie simple commands such as "sit" or "down". This will help him stay calm and decrease the chance of him jumping on guests and running across the street.
You should also teach your Frenchie how to drop toys or objects they hold in their mouths. This will keep them from destroying and biting objects that they shouldn't be playing with or chewing on. You can achieve this by giving with them something more desirable than the thing they currently have in their mouths, like treats or toys. This can aid in helping your Frenchie learn to let things go and not hold on to them for too long which could lead to the guarding of resources.
You can teach your French Bulldog how to calmly greet people and other animals through training. This will prevent them from barking excessively or alerting you when strangers are in the area. This is particularly important if you live in a place with many guests.

Feeding
Frenchies have a lot of personality into their sturdy little frames, and require extra care right from the start. They must be cautiously weaned from mom's milk at an early age, and franzöSische bulldogge Welpen zu kaufen this is something that the breeder should do (unless there are circumstances that warrant it). When a puppy is completely weaned, they'll require a high quality commercial kibble food that provides the proper balance of proteins, fats, carbohydrates, minerals, and vitamins.
A diet high in protein is especially important for Frenchies due to the fact that they tend to gain weight quickly. It is also a good idea to select a dog food that is specifically made for puppies, as this will give your French Bulldog puppy the nutrients they require at their developmental stage.
A smaller kibble can make it easier for the French Bulldog to chew and take in. A kibble that is too large can cause your Frenchie to swallow it without chewing it properly and this could lead to stomach upset or choke. You can also aid in easing your Frenchie's digestion by ensuring that they are drinking plenty of water to drink at all times.
Due to their brachycephalic (meaning that they have a short skull and a muzzle that is flat or pulled into it) breed, Frenchies can have breathing problems at certain times of the year, especially during hot weather. You can alleviate these issues by ensuring that your Frenchie on an eating plan that is high in fibre and low in sugar, and staying clear of processed foods and treats.
